With 'real' staff and regulars. Most of whom have their own glass, and a usual chair and drink. It's not quite Cheers, but almost everybody knows your name. If they don't, people will say hello to you and may even start a conversation.
Whilst it is frequented by 'old men' and scraggy looking dogs. It's not an old man's pub. Be it the tables of outdoorsy times in for an apres-climb pint, the Thai-ladies-that-lunch (well shop then neck a pint of wheat beer and get giggly), the quiz league or the live action role play group, it's a pub for everyone. (Well except kids).
It's the kind of pub you can go and have a quite pint in, bring in your fish and chips to eat with your pint, or stop all night, putting the world to rights.
Then, there's the booze: Six regular beers, five guest ales, two draft ciders, four draft lagers, couple boxes / kegs of scrumpy and perry, thirty to fifty bottled beers and lagers, several bottled ciders, thirty whiskies, half a dozen vodkas and selection of spirits, liqueurs and fruit wines.
The numbers don't really do it justice though. As Stockport & South Manchester CAMRA's Cider Pub of the Year 2013 and winner of loads of other beery awards, it's the kind of place that will do you a taste of the beer/cider/perry before buying, has Leffe on as a guest beer (in pints) and does it's own beer and cider festivals.
Beers range from 3% and just over £2 a pint though to 13% and £5 a bottle. While they don't take cards, some of our friends are more surprised by how much change they get from a round. read more
